> - Do I need to set a default host? I have a Linux box which I can
> create users on, but I thought that Radius would eliminate this
> necessity.

No, this is only if you have shell accounts on a Unix server you want
users to be able to log directly into by dialing in (instead of telnetting
from a ppp account0. This is also only used if you don't specify the host
to telnet to in the Radius users file.

> - What type of Port Type (Login?, Network/Login?) do I want for a PM
> users table authentication? (When I switch to Radius authentication?)

I set mine up as "login network dialin" to allow shell logins, network
(ppp) logins and dialin only (not out which would be twoway).

> - What type of Login Service (Telnet, Rlogin, Portmaster) do I want for
> a PM users table authentication?

It doesn't matter unless you are using a Unix server with shell accounts..
in which case I recommend rlogin ir in.pmd ("Portmaster") if your platform
is supported (a lot aren't).

> - I can see that the win95 client is receiving a prompt from the PM. I
> looks like garbage characters though. I assume this is the Login prompt
> with some type of encryption?

No. When it answers and there is garbage it means (most likely) that the
speed of the modems and the Portmaster on your end probably aren't set
right.

Make sure you are using the same three speeds - usually 115200 with
today's modems.

set s0 speed 115200
set s0 speed 2 115200
set s0 speed 3 115200

And lock the speed of the modem's serial port at the 115200 speed. You'll
probably want to use RTS/CTS and no XON/XOFF for flow control on your
ports.
